Output 93e10725a240200b63ffbd1199db626d192cf6c90ed4240617150bd21c5ddfbf:2

value
2403472609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d1ae799919dbb5bf3fcb4e60ff885c548aeb8ab OP_EQUAL
address
3D6WctkFMFEN7piDhepRxk2KbE2X9MvwQR
transaction
93e10725a240200b63ffbd1199db626d192cf6c90ed4240617150bd21c5ddfbf
spent
true